Default Car boggs at Full Throttle after obd0-obd1 conversion?

just did an obd0-obd1 conversion. after lots of kicking and screaming, there are no more check engine lights. BUT after about 2500rpm if hit full throttle the rpm goes nuts. it goes to up and down crazy. it does this at about anything over 50% plus throttle. i have NO idea what the hell is wrong with my car. can anyone shed some light PLEASE.

Default Re: Car boggs at Full Throttle after obd0-obd1 conversion? (90teg)

My car did the same thing when i reversed the plugs from my MAP and TPS. So I figure it has to be somewhere on the MAP or TPS.

Check for continuity between the plug on the sensor and the corresponding wire on the ecu plug.

It could also be possible that the harness was put together incorrectly and a wire might be switched

Just giving you pointers to start w/
